Voters in several Oklahoma counties headed to the polls on Tuesday to decide in several races, including some school bond issues.
Osage County- Anderson Schools bond vote
Voters approved one bond issue for Anderson Schools and two others failed.
The $1,095,000 bond to fix draining and roofing damage passed, but the $1,095,000 proposition to fix paving and parking lots and the $220,000 proposition for transportation failed.
This is the third time this year the district has tried to pass a bond issue.
